Alibaba Cloud is seeking a motivated attorney in London with significant European employment law background. The role involves counseling on employment issues, managing disputes, and training stakeholders, requiring a legal qualification and 5-7 years of relevant experience. Strong English and Chinese communication skills are essential. This position offers the opportunity to work in a dynamic, multi-national setting with travel to Europe and China planned.

How to prepare for a job interview at Alibaba Cloud
✨Know Your Employment Law Inside Out
Make sure you brush up on the latest developments in European employment law. Be prepared to discuss recent cases or changes in legislation that could impact Alibaba Cloud, as this shows your expertise and genuine interest in the field.
✨Showcase Your Dispute Management Skills
Think of specific examples where you've successfully managed disputes or provided counsel on employment issues.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ers, making it easy for the interviewers to see your problem-solving abilities in action.
✨Demonstrate Cultural Awareness
Since this role involves travel to Europe and China, highlight any experience you have working in multi-national settings. Discuss how you’ve navigated cultural differences in past roles, especially in legal contexts, to show you can adapt and thrive in diverse environments.
✨Practice Your Bilingual Communication
Given the importance of strong English and Chinese communication skills, consider preparing a few key legal concepts or scenarios in both languages. This will not only help you feel more confident but also demonstrate your ability to communicate effectively with stakeholders from different backgrounds.
